Using plant palettes based on area of origin as points of departure, a unique plant palette is created for each client. Within each palette, plants that serve specific purposes are chosen, in addition to plants that provide interest throughout the year.

Terraced fruit tree planters in combination with flowering plants at drainage wash
Including fruit trees and areas for growing vegetables is a recurring landscape design request. This can be accomplished in a number of ways depending on the needs and desires of the client. In the above example, terraced planters for fruit trees were combined with native grasses and grass-like plants, colorful perennials, and an ever-blooming slope cover that attracts hummingbirds and beneficial insects.
